Anxiety runs in families due to a combination of inherent and environmental factors. Anxious parents may produce anxious children. When signs are so severe that they interfere with daily life activities, it is time to seek an evaluation from a mental health professional.
Consider the following example of a child who suffered stress disorder. Maria, age 12, was at her physician's office awaiting her yearly checkup. A bullet from a gun battle in the next building tore through the wall and struck her mother in the shoulder, severely wounding her. The mother was rushed to the hospital, but Mafia did not know her fate for several days.
Unable or unwilling to speak, visibly anxious and fearful, Mafia was evaluated by a child doctor in the same hospital several days later. He recommended a brief treatment and began by taking Mafia to her mother's bedside.
Mafia, reassured that her mother was alive, nevertheless could not be separated from her. During the following weeks she insisted on sleeping with her mother and would not let her out of her sight. Her mother was equally shocked, and told her daughter she was suffering great pain.
The doctor began a series of play treatment sessions using dolls and paly surgical instruments in which Mafia performed operations in her doll hospital. She began to get great pleasure in her sessions. Her mother did not recover so quickly, so the doctor recommended individual treatment for her.
The final sessions involved Mafia performing the operation on, not a doll, but her mother, who submitted to patient status once again. Playing out the painful theme was extremely beneficial, and with a minimum of interpretation, both were back to their normal functioning by the month's end, Mafia did not need any medication.
There are many ways of helping anxious children cope with their fears and worries. A careful evaluation and specific treatment plan can help these children get back on the path of normal development.
